The Dhaka-New Jalpaiguri train will run twice a week

The passenger train from Dhaka to New Jalpaiguri in West Bengal, India will be launched on March 26. The information was given after a meeting of railway officials of the two countries on Wednesday. This will be the third railway service of Bangladesh with West Bengal. The train will run every Monday and Thursday. 

Rabindra Kumar Verma, DRM (Divisional Railway Manager), Katihar Division, Indian Railways, told reporters. Concerned officials of Bangladesh Railway have also admitted it. It is planned to start this train service from Dhaka Cantonment to New Jalpaiguri or NJP in West Bengal on the occasion of the golden jubilee of Bangladesh’s independence and the birth centenary of Father of the Nation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man. 

Bangladesh Railway Director General Dhirendranath Majumder told Dhaka Post this afternoon, “We want to increase railways and trains between the two countries.”

On 14 April 2006, the first passenger train, the Maitri Express, was launched between Dhaka and Kolkata on the Bengali New Year. On November 9, 2016, the second railway service ‘Bondhan Express’ was launched with Khulna and Kolkata. 

Several officials of the management branch of Bangladesh Railway told Dhaka Post that train services are being increased to increase trade and tourism between Bangladesh and India. 

The name and ticket price of the train that will be launched from the capital Dhaka to New Jalpaiguri in India on March 26 will be fixed soon. The train will have 10 compartments. It will run from Dhaka to New Jalpaiguri in 9 hours. 

Mohammad Shahidullah Islam, Divisional Railway Manager, Bangladesh, Rabindra Kumar, Divisional Manager, North Frontier Railway, India and Shailendra, DRM, Sealdah Division also briefed the Indian media at a joint press conference. Source: Dhaka Post
